Removing Tranny. I cannot figure out how the "HKS GD Clutch Max Twin Plate Clutch" is connected to the shift fork/throwout bearing.
I have done multiple clutch jobs on standard OE replacement clutches in the EVO, (ACT, Clutch Masters, etc.), but this is not connected the same way.
How do I release the shift-fork/throwout from the HKS pressure plate?

Just remove the 2 10mm bolt on the top of the tranny, that hold on to the rod that slight thru the shift fork, pull out the rod and the transmission is free for remover.
